Apart from that, just from a design and personal taste standpoint, if you played the original SoC and really, really valued the A-Life system in that game and that's a super specific thing you demand be replicated or improved upon in HoC, maybe hold off for a while.
While I personally don't mind the current implementation (I'm more in the "A-life is nice to have, but doesn't really make or break the experience for me" camp myself,) and while they just patched it to massively improve the sense of life and dynamism in the Zone, it's still not up to some people's standards in that regard. Depends on your personal criteria/demands.
I think it's a great, atmospheric, tense game though. And so is this, in obviously very different ways.
